Types of Welder’s Qualifications
Although the AWS’ standard Certified Welder certificate helps make you eligible for most job opportunities, a number of fields call for a specialized certification. A handful of the most-popular of which appear below.
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for individuals that work with pipelines in the energy industry
- ASME Certification for individuals that work on boiler and pressurized vessels
- SCWI and CWI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ors
- CW Certification to become a Certified Welder

The data illustrates employment and salary projections for welding professionals in Maryland through 2022.
| Maryland |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 2,620 | 2,700 | 3% | 70 |
| Maryland |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$28,000 | $42,700 | $69,800 |
Source: O*Net Online
What You Should be Aware of When Choosing Welder Schools in Broadfording, MD
You will find plenty of fantastic welding schools all around the United States, but you should be aware of which of the welding schools represent the best option. As soon as you get started looking around, you’ll find tons of training programs, but exactly what do you have to look for when selecting welding specialist courses? It is highly recommended that you verify that the training programs continue to be accepted either through a overseeing body like the American Welding Society. If the accreditation status is good, you may want to check several other features of the program as compared with other schools providing the same training.
- Look for programs that cover AWS SENSE standards
- Be certain the school trains with tools that suits present industry standards
- Find out if the program offers financial assistance
- You should make sure the college’s program features courses in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
